Why Study Business in Turkey?
Turkey presents a unique set of advantages for aspiring business professionals. The country boasts a rapidly growing economy, attracting numerous international companies and fostering a competitive business environment. Studying here provides invaluable exposure to this dynamic market. Furthermore, the comparatively affordable tuition fees at many universities, coupled with the opportunity for high-quality education at low cost, make Turkey a financially accessible option for international students. The availability of English-taught programs in Turkey simplifies the transition for non-Turkish speakers. Beyond academics, the rich cultural experience in Turkey adds another layer to the overall study abroad experience, offering personal growth and intercultural competence.

Student Life in Turkey
Student life in Turkey is vibrant and engaging. The best Turkish cities for student life offer a diverse range of activities and experiences. Istanbul, Ankara, and Izmir are particularly popular student hubs, offering a rich cultural experience and abundant opportunities for social interaction. Student dormitories in Turkish universities and accommodation options near campus in Turkey provide comfortable and convenient living arrangements. Part-time work opportunities for students in Turkey also exist, helping to manage living costs in Turkey for students.
